Best Practices for Implementation: Tips and Tricks for Waterfall and Agile
Implementing Waterfall or Agile methodologies requires a thoughtful and structured approach. Best practices for Waterfall include creating a detailed project plan, establishing clear communication channels, and setting realistic milestones and deadlines. For example, a project manager can use the Gantt chart technique to visualize the project schedule and dependencies, ensuring that all team members are on the same page. In contrast, Agile methodologies emphasize the importance of iterative development, continuous testing, and regular feedback. A key best practice for Agile is to use the Scrum framework, which involves daily stand-up meetings, sprint planning, and retrospectives to ensure that the team is aligned and working towards a common goal. By following these best practices, you can ensure a smooth and successful project execution, regardless of the methodology you choose.
Career Opportunities and Industry Applications: Where Waterfall and Agile Meet
Professional Certificates in Waterfall and Agile can open up a wide range of career opportunities in various industries, including IT, construction, finance, and healthcare. With a deep understanding of these methodologies, you can pursue roles such as project manager, program manager, or portfolio manager, and work on complex projects that require meticulous planning and execution. For instance, in the IT industry, Agile methodologies are widely used in software development, where teams need to be agile and responsive to changing customer needs. In the construction industry, Waterfall methodologies are often used for large-scale infrastructure projects, where a linear and sequential approach is necessary to ensure that the project is completed on time and within budget. Additionally, many organizations are now adopting a hybrid approach, combining elements of both Waterfall and Agile to create a tailored methodology that suits their specific needs.
